Serratoga Falls
By Jessica Car · Updated April 2026
A high-end community east of I-25 off Highway 14, originally developed as a premier neighborhood with extensive landscaping, open space, and mountain views. Homes range from $750K to $1.2M with spacious floor plans and premium finishes. Quick I-25 access makes Denver commuting feasible.
